BAUGH v. STATE

No. CR-21-128.

635 S.W.3d 9 (2021)

2021 Ark. App. 400

Jimmy Marion BAUGH, Appellant v. STATE of Arkansas, Appellee.

Court of Appeals of Arkansas, Division IV.

Opinion Delivered October 20, 2021.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

ARK AG LAW, PLLC, by: J. Grant Ballard , Little Rock, for appellant.

Leslie Rutledge , Att'y Gen., by: Jacob H. Jones , Ass't Att'y Gen., for appellee.
